What Causes Hair Loss?

Hair loss is a common concern that affects both men and women. Understanding the underlying causes can help individuals navigate the available options for hair restoration, including hair transplant surgery.

Several factors can contribute to hair loss:

  1. Genetic predisposition: Inherited genes can play a significant role in determining the pattern and extent of hair loss.
  2. Hormonal changes: Fluctuations in hormone levels, such as those that occur during pregnancy, menopause, or thyroid disorders, can lead to hair loss.
  3. Stress and medical conditions: Physical and emotional stress, as well as certain medical conditions like alopecia areata or scalp infections, can result in hair loss.
  4. Diet and nutrition: Inadequate intake of essential nutrients, especially those vital for hair health, can contribute to hair loss.
  5. Medications and treatments: Certain medications, such as chemotherapy drugs, as well as treatments like radiation therapy, can cause temporary or permanent hair loss.
  6. Excessive styling and heat damage: Frequent use of heating tools, harsh chemical treatments, and tight hairstyles can damage the hair follicles, leading to hair loss.

Hair transplant surgery offers a long-term solution for individuals experiencing hair loss. It involves the transplantation of healthy hair follicles from one area of the scalp (or donor site) to the areas where hair thinning or baldness is evident (or recipient site).

What Is a Hair Follicle Transplant?

A hair follicle transplant is a revolutionary procedure that offers a long-term solution for individuals struggling with hair loss. This innovative technique involves the extraction of healthy hair follicles from one area of the scalp and their transplantation to areas experiencing hair thinning or baldness. One of the most popular methods of hair follicle transplant is follicular unit extraction (FUE).

Follicular unit extraction (FUE) is a minimally invasive procedure that allows for the precise harvesting and transplantation of individual hair follicles. During the FUE process, a skilled surgeon uses a specialized instrument to extract follicular units containing one to four hair follicles from the donor area. These follicular units are then carefully implanted into the recipient area, ensuring natural-looking results and promoting hair growth.

The FUE technique is preferred by many patients and surgeons due to its effectiveness, minimal scarring, and minimal downtime. Unlike traditional hair transplant techniques, FUE does not require a linear incision or the removal of a strip of scalp. Instead, it utilizes small, circular punches to extract the individual follicular units, resulting in minimal scarring and a faster recovery time.

Permanent Hair Restoration

A hair follicle transplant offers a permanent solution to hair loss. The transplanted hair follicles are resistant to the hormone DHT, which is the primary cause of male and female pattern baldness. This means that the transplanted hair will continue to grow naturally even after the procedure, ensuring long-lasting results.

The Hair Transplant Procedure

Are you considering a hair transplant procedure to restore your hairline? Understanding the step-by-step process can help you make an informed decision. In this section, we will provide a comprehensive overview of what to expect during the treatment, from the initial consultation to post-operative care.

Step 1: Consultation and Assessment

The first step in the hair transplant procedure is a thorough consultation with a qualified specialist at a reputable hair transplant clinic. During this consultation, the specialist will assess your hair loss condition, examine the donor area (usually the back or sides of the head), and discuss your goals and expectations.

Using this information, the specialist will determine if you are a suitable candidate for a hair transplant and explain the different hair restoration techniques available, such as Follicular Unit Extraction (FUE) or Follicular Unit Transplantation (FUT).

Step 2: Donor Hair Extraction

Once you have decided to proceed with the hair transplant procedure, the next step is the extraction of healthy hair follicles from the donor area. This is typically done under local anesthesia to ensure a comfortable experience.

If you opt for FUE, individual hair follicles are extracted using a specialized punch tool. On the other hand, with FUT, a thin strip of hair-bearing skin is removed from the donor area, which is then divided into individual grafts containing hair follicles.

Step 3: Graft Preparation

After the donor hair extraction, the grafts are carefully dissected and prepared for transplantation. The goal is to create small, healthy grafts that will enhance the chances of successful hair growth after the procedure.

Step 4: Recipient Site Creation

With the grafts prepared, the surgeon will create tiny incisions in the recipient area, where the hair transplant will take place. The precise placement and angle of the incisions are crucial to achieve a natural-looking hairline and optimal hair growth.

Step 5: Graft Transplantation

Once the recipient sites are ready, the surgeon will begin transplanting the prepared grafts into these sites. The surgeon’s experience and skill play a critical role in ensuring the correct placement and distribution of the grafts for the best aesthetic results.

Step 6: Post-Operative Care

After the transplant is complete, the clinic will provide you with detailed instructions on post-operative care. This may include guidelines on how to cleanse the recipient area, manage swelling or discomfort, and protect the newly transplanted hair.

Follow-up appointments will be scheduled to monitor your progress and provide any necessary adjustments or additional treatments, if required, to optimize hair growth.

Factors Affecting Hair Transplant Cost

Understanding the cost of a hair transplant is essential for individuals considering the procedure and planning their budget accordingly. Several factors can influence the overall expense of a hair transplant, and it’s important to be aware of these elements to make an informed decision.

1. Procedure Type:

The specific hair transplant procedure chosen can significantly impact the overall cost. Two commonly used techniques are Follicular Unit Extraction (FUE) and Follicular Unit Transplantation (FUT). While FUE is known for its precision and individual graft extraction, it may come at a higher cost compared to FUT.

2. Extent of Hair Loss:

The extent of hair loss and the desired outcome can influence the cost of a hair transplant. Patients with a larger area of thinning or baldness may require more grafts, resulting in a higher cost. The number of grafts needed for the procedure can vary from person to person.

3. Clinic Reputation:

The reputation and expertise of the hair transplant clinic or surgeon can influence the cost. Highly reputable clinics or surgeons with extensive experience in hair restoration may charge a premium for their services.

4. Geographic Location:

The location of the clinic can also impact the cost of a hair transplant. In general, clinics in major cities or urban areas may have higher prices due to higher overhead costs and demand.

5. Additional Treatments:

Additional treatments that may be required alongside the hair transplant, such as platelet-rich plasma (PRP) therapy or scalp micropigmentation, can contribute to the overall cost. These treatments can enhance the results of the hair transplant but may come at an additional expense.

6. Clinic Facilities:

The facilities provided by the clinic, such as the use of advanced technology, a comfortable environment, and post-operative care, can influence the cost of a hair transplant. Clinics that invest in state-of-the-art equipment and offer comprehensive care may have higher prices.

7. Geographic Arbitrage:

In some cases, individuals may consider traveling to another country for their hair transplant to take advantage of lower costs. However, it’s essential to thoroughly research the clinic, surgeon, and overall safety of the procedure when considering international options.

Recovery After Hair Follicle Transplant

After undergoing a hair follicle transplant, it’s important to follow proper recovery guidelines to ensure optimal results. The recovery process plays a crucial role in the success of the procedure and achieving natural-looking hair restoration. Here, we will provide you with important information to help you navigate through the recovery period with ease.

Managing Post-Operative Discomfort

It’s common to experience some discomfort following a hair follicle transplant. You may notice mild pain, tenderness, or swelling in the treated area. However, these symptoms are temporary and can be effectively managed with prescribed pain medication and following your surgeon’s post-operative care instructions.

During the initial days after the procedure, it’s crucial to keep the transplanted area clean and avoid touching or scratching it. Gently washing your scalp with a mild cleanser as instructed by your surgeon will help keep the area free from infection.

Timeline for Hair Growth

It’s important to note that the timeline for hair growth after a follicle transplant varies from person to person. While some individuals may start to see new hair growth as early as three months after the procedure, it can take up to one year for the full results to become apparent.

During the first few weeks, you may notice that the transplanted hair falls out. This is a natural part of the process, and it allows for new hair to start growing. Don’t worry, as this is temporary and new hair will begin to emerge within a few months.

Follow-up Care

Regular follow-up appointments with your surgeon are essential to monitor your progress and ensure proper healing. Your surgeon will provide you with detailed instructions on how to care for your scalp, including any necessary medications or topical solutions.

It’s important to avoid any strenuous activities or exercise that may cause excessive sweating or trauma to the scalp during the initial healing phase. Protecting your scalp from direct sunlight is also crucial, so wearing a hat or using sunscreen when outdoors is recommended.

Risks and Considerations

While hair follicle transplant is a safe and effective procedure for hair restoration, it is important to be aware of the potential risks and considerations involved. Before undergoing the treatment, it is essential to thoroughly understand these factors and discuss them with a qualified surgeon.

Potential Complications

Like any surgical procedure, hair transplant surgery carries some inherent risks. While these risks are rare, it is crucial to be aware of them before making a decision. Some potential complications may include:

  • Infection: Although rare, there is a slight risk of developing an infection at the transplant site. This can typically be managed with proper post-operative care and antibiotics.
  • Scarring: While modern hair transplant techniques minimize scarring, there is still a possibility of visible scarring, particularly in individuals prone to keloid scars.
  • Bleeding: As with any surgical procedure, there may be some bleeding during and after the transplant. This is typically minimal and can be controlled by the surgeon.
  • Temporary Shock Loss: Following the procedure, some individuals may experience temporary shock loss, where the transplanted hair falls out before regrowth occurs. This is a normal part of the process and should not cause concern.

Considerations Before Treatment

Prior to undergoing a hair follicle transplant, it is important to consider the following factors:

  1. Health Condition: Individuals with underlying health conditions, such as diabetes or autoimmune disorders, should consult with their healthcare provider before proceeding with a hair transplant.
  2. Expected Results: It is essential to have realistic expectations about the outcome of a hair transplant. While the procedure can significantly improve hair density and restore a natural appearance, it may not achieve the same results for everyone.
  3. Cost and Affordability: Hair transplant surgery can be a significant investment. It is crucial to assess the cost and determine affordability based on individual circumstances.
  4. Recovery Time: Hair transplant surgery requires a recovery period, during which individuals may need to take time off work and avoid strenuous activities. Planning for this downtime is essential.
  5. Commitment to Follow-Up Care: Following a hair follicle transplant, ongoing care and maintenance are necessary for optimal results. This may include regular check-ups, medications, and following post-operative instructions provided by the surgeon.

FAQ

What is hair follicle transplant?

Hair follicle transplant is a surgical procedure that involves harvesting hair follicles from one part of the body, typically the back of the scalp, and transplanting them to areas with thinning or no hair. This procedure is also known as follicular unit extraction (FUE) and can help individuals restore their natural hair growth.

How does hair follicle transplant work?

During a hair follicle transplant, healthy hair follicles are carefully extracted from the donor area using specialized instruments. These follicles are then meticulously transplanted into tiny incisions made in the recipient area. Over time, the transplanted follicles establish a blood supply and start growing hair in the new location.

Is hair follicle transplant suitable for everyone?

Hair follicle transplant is a suitable option for individuals with pattern hair loss, also known as androgenetic alopecia. However, the eligibility for the procedure may vary based on factors such as the extent of hair loss, donor hair availability, and overall health. It is best to consult with a qualified hair transplant surgeon to determine if you are a suitable candidate.

How long does the hair transplant procedure take?

The duration of a hair transplant procedure depends on the extent of the treatment and the number of grafts being transplanted. On average, the procedure can take anywhere from a few hours to a full day. During your initial consultation, the surgeon will provide a more accurate estimate based on your specific case.

Is hair transplant surgery painful?

Hair transplant surgery is typically performed under local anesthesia, which numbs the scalp and minimizes discomfort during the procedure. However, some patients may experience mild discomfort or soreness in the donor and recipient areas after the surgery. Pain medication can be prescribed to manage any post-operative discomfort.

How long does it take to recover from a hair follicle transplant?

The recovery time after a hair follicle transplant can vary depending on individual healing capabilities, the extent of the procedure, and the post-operative care. Most patients can resume their normal activities within a week, but it may take several months for the transplanted hair to grow and fully blend with the existing hair.

What are the potential risks and complications of a hair transplant?

While hair follicle transplant is generally considered safe and effective, like any surgical procedure, there are potential risks and complications. These may include infection, bleeding, scarring, and the possibility of an inadequate hair growth outcome. Consulting a skilled and experienced hair transplant surgeon and following their post-operative care instructions can help minimize these risks.

How much does a hair follicle transplant cost?

The cost of a hair follicle transplant can vary depending on factors such as the clinic, the surgeon’s expertise, the number of grafts needed, and the geographic location. On average, the cost can range from several thousand to tens of thousands of dollars. It is recommended to consult with multiple clinics and surgeons to obtain accurate cost estimates.

How long do the results of a hair transplant last?

The results of a hair follicle transplant are considered permanent. Once the transplanted hair follicles start growing, they will continue to do so for a lifetime. However, it is important to note that the natural aging process and individual factors may affect hair density and appearance over time. Regular follow-up care and maintenance can help preserve the results.
